Copenhagen’s Dark Star of Contemporary Fashion
In the world of contemporary menswear, where maximalism often reigns supreme, Heliot Emil stands apart as a beacon of refined minimalism with a futuristic edge. Founded by brothers Julius and Victor Juul in Copenhagen, Denmark, this avant-garde label has rapidly ascended from underground favorite to Paris Fashion Week mainstay, earning critical acclaim from fashion industry heavyweights like Hypebeast, Highsnobiety, Vogue Scandinavia, and WWD.

Named after the founders’ great-grandfather, Heliot Emil made its debut at Milan Fashion Week for Spring/Summer 2017, and since then, the brand has been on an unstoppable trajectory, recognized as one of the most provocative in the game Highsnobiety. The Heliot Emil Aesthetic: Where Brutalism Meets High Fashion
A Monochromatic Vision
Heliot Emil’s aesthetic is characterized by its severe, almost brutalist juxtaposition of utilitarianism, streetwear and tailoring in a largely monochromatic universe WWD. The brand’s signature palette of black, gray, silver, and stone creates a canvas for experimentation with texture, silhouette, and innovative construction techniques.
Highsnobiety Commerce Content Curator Rhianna Matthews describes the brand as her favorite, praising that “they have a perfect fit and shape, plus they use high-quality materials and luxurious detailing without being too heavy on your wallet” Highsnobiety.
Experimental Approach to Design
What truly distinguishes Heliot Emil from other Scandinavian minimalist brands is its experimental approach. According to Highsnobiety, the brand has “a penchant for dark, unsavory references, inside-out garments, contrast stitching, lots of straps, bondage, asymmetrical fixtures, semi-transparent materials, and metallic hardware such as rock-climbing carabiners” Highsnobiety. The result is a series of futuristic, industrial silhouettes that feel simultaneously dystopian and aspirational.
The Impression noted that “Juul’s version is cleaner and more ‘techy’ than Owen’s signature beautifully dystopian underworld” The Impression, positioning Heliot Emil as a distinct voice in the Rick Owens-adjacent universe of avant-garde fashion.

Innovation and Technology: Heliot Emil’s Forward-Thinking Approach
AI Integration and Design
One of the most fascinating aspects of Heliot Emil’s recent evolution has been its embrace of artificial intelligence in the design process. For Spring/Summer 2024, Julius Juul fed the brand’s past work into a computer and embarked on “the challenging task of editing and deciphering the machine’s interpretations of their unique design DNAs, ultimately translating them into wearable garments” My Face Hunter.
The experiment resulted in unexpected softness and increased use of draping, demonstrating that technology can reveal new dimensions within an intentional brand Kendam. This willingness to experiment with cutting-edge technology while maintaining artistic integrity exemplifies Heliot Emil’s philosophy of looking forward rather than backward.
Collaborations with Technical Innovators
Heliot Emil’s ongoing collaboration with Alpinestars, an Italian brand that makes protective gear for motorsports, exemplifies the label’s commitment to looking at “extraneous innovations, happening outside of fashion” Vogue Scandinavia. By incorporating fireproof materials and soft armor from the motorsports world, the brand creates garments that serve as both physical and emotional protection.
For Spring/Summer 2025, Heliot Emil unveiled collaborations with PUMA and STACCATO, combining utilitarian design with sportswear expertise jtdapperfashionweek, further cementing its reputation as a brand that seamlessly blends fashion with function.

Signature Pieces and Collections
Hardware and Construction Details
The devil is in the details with Heliot Emil. The brand is known for its usage of custom textiles, including its signature metal liquid fabric, and cutout pieces that have a graceful presentation on the body Hypebeast. Each hardware detail is created from the ground up with both form and function in mind, resulting in pieces that are as sculptural as they are wearable.
Recent Collections
The Fall/Winter 2024 collection, titled “Shelter,” explored the concept of protection through contrasting hard and soft elements, with models wearing razor-sharp suits, body-con shapes with cutouts, and oversize jackets Hypebeast. The collection featured gleaming foil effects and metal hardware that furthered the futuristic aesthetic.
Standout pieces included outerwear crafted with meticulous attention to detail, with Julius Juul’s focus shifting towards upgrading and softening fabrications rather than pursuing avant-garde silhouettes Kendam.
